Obituary for Linda M Haefke

Linda M. Haefke, age 67, of Austintown passed away on Sunday, May 15, 2016 at the University of Pittsburgh Medical Center following a long illness. Born September 29, 1948 in Ayer, Mass.; she was the daughter of Robert and Irene (Campbell) McDowell.
Linda was a member of the Youngstown-Salem USBC Women''s Bowling Association for nearly 40 years; she was inducted into the Hall of Fame in 2012. She won many tournaments, held several offices, and belonged to several leagues over the years.
Her family was everything to her, she loved her children and grandchildren and loved spending time and baby-sitting them. Survivors include her husband of 44 years, James F. Haefke; children: Tammy (Bill) Diver, Teri (Chad) Haefke, and Jimmy (Jackie) Haefke; grandchildren: Kala (Cody), Zack, Raelynn, Devin, and Katelynn; great-grandson Tanner; sisters Patricia (Jim) Ramsden and Roberta Pelletier, a brother Richard McDowell; and many nephews and nieces. She was preceded in death by her parents and a sister Marjorie Wright.
